Gameplay and Features
French roulette is similar to European roulette, with the main difference being the La Partage rule. This rule gives players the opportunity to recover half of their bet if the ball lands on zero. This significantly reduces the house edge, making French roulette a popular choice among players looking for better odds.
Features of French roulette low house edge Australia certified include:
- La Partage rule for lower house edge
- Single zero wheel
- Call bets for additional wagering options
House Edge
The house edge in French roulette with a low house edge is around 1.35%, making it one of the most player-friendly versions of the game. This gives players a better chance of winning compared to other variations of roulette.
House Edge Comparison:
| Game | House Edge |
|---|---|
| French Roulette Low House Edge | 1.35% |
| American Roulette | 5.26% |
| European Roulette | 2.70% |
Payouts
French roulette with a low house edge offers the same payouts as other versions of the game. The standard payouts are as follows:
- Straight bet – 35:1
- Split bet – 17:1
- Even/Odd – 1:1
